On January 4, 2026, Wang Yi, member of the Political Bureau of the CPC Central Committee and Foreign Minister, held the 7th Sino-Pakistani Foreign Minister Strategic Dialogue with Pakistan's Deputy Prime Minister and Foreign Minister Dar in Beijing. Wang Yi said that the current international situation has become more chaotic and intertwined, and the phenomenon of unilateral bullying is intensifying. The sudden change in the situation in Venezuela has drawn great attention from the international community, and a spokesman for the Chinese Ministry of Foreign Affairs has stated China's position. We never believed that any country could act as an international police officer, nor did we agree that any country can claim to be an international judge, and that the sovereignty and security of all countries should be fully protected by international law. We have always opposed the use or threat of use of force in international relations and the imposition of the will of one country on another. China is ready to work with the international community, including Pakistan, to firmly defend the Charter of the United Nations, adhere to the bottom line of international morality, adhere to the sovereign equality of all countries, jointly maintain world peace and development, and jointly promote the building of a community of human destiny.
